My personal EQ preferences

My personal EQ preferences

When it comes to my personal EQ preferences, I usually gravitate towards enhancing the 3 kHz to 5 kHz range. I see this as the sweet spot for vocals, making every word crisp and clear. There’s something special about hearing that emotional nuance in a singer’s voice that can instantly draw in the audience.

On occasion, I find myself boosting the low-end frequencies, particularly around 60 Hz, which adds that powerful thump essential for dance tracks. I recall a night at an electronic music event when I pushed that range slightly higher than usual. The floor vibrated with energy, and I could see people moving to the beat, completely lost in the music. It’s moments like these that remind me how impactful a minor adjustment can be.

Conversely, I’m careful with the higher frequencies above 12 kHz. I often engage in a gentle cut to avoid that harshness that can make the sound too piercing. There’s nothing worse than seeing an audience wince during a performance; I strive for a balance that invites them in rather than pushes them away. How do you prefer to set your EQ during live shows? I genuinely believe it’s all about experimentation and finding what resonates personally with both you and the audience.

Modifying EQ for different venues

Modifying EQ for different venues

When modifying EQ for different venues, I always consider the unique acoustics of each space. For example, I once worked an event in a warehouse that had a lot of hard surfaces. It was crucial to dial back the mid-range frequencies to prevent the sound from becoming too boomy. Have you ever noticed how certain venues seem to suck the energy right out of the music? Adjusting EQ settings can really transform that experience.

In outdoor venues, the challenges shift entirely. I remember a festival in an open field where wind played tricks on the sound. To combat this, I focused on enhancing the low mids around 250 Hz for warmth and body, which helped ground the sound even in the blustery conditions. It’s fascinating how small tweaks can make all the difference in conveying that live energy, don’t you agree?

When I encounter smaller, more intimate venues, I tend to adopt a different approach. I recall mixing for a seated audience in a jazz club, where I deliberately pulled back on the low end to maintain clarity and intimacy in the performance. The result was a more personal connection with the artists on stage, almost like sharing a private moment. Adapting EQ settings based on venue specifics not only enhances sound quality but also elevates the entire experience for the audience.

Troubleshooting common EQ issues

Troubleshooting common EQ issues

When I’m troubleshooting EQ issues, the first step is to listen carefully to the mix. I remember a gig where the vocals seemed to be drowning in the instrumentation. After a quick assessment, I realized I needed to cut some of the low frequencies from the vocals and boost the highs around 3 kHz. This simple change helped the singer’s voice cut through beautifully, turning a muddled performance into one that was crystal clear.

Another common issue involves feedback, which can be very frustrating in live situations. I once faced this dilemma during a corporate event where the podium mic was picking up feedback from the speakers behind it. By adjusting the EQ and applying a notch filter around the feedback frequency, I was able to eliminate the screeching sound. It’s incredible how a few minor adjustments can save the day and maintain a professional atmosphere.

Unexpected problems can also arise due to venue-specific acoustics. I had a memorable experience at a rustic barn where the low end was overwhelming. After experimenting with a few tweaks, I found that reducing frequencies below 80 Hz brought a much better balance, allowing the music to breathe while still providing that rich, full sound. Isn’t it amazing how different spaces can dramatically change the audio landscape?

Tips for fine-tuning EQ settings

Tips for fine-tuning EQ settings

When fine-tuning EQ settings, don’t hesitate to trust your ears above all else. I recall a time at an outdoor festival where I had an artist whose live set included a lot of punchy bass. After a sound check, I spent a good 20 minutes adjusting frequencies, experimenting with subtle boosts and cuts. I can’t emphasize enough the importance of listening; sometimes, it’s the small tweaks that make the biggest impact, like when simply lowering a few dB around 200 Hz improved the overall clarity of the mix.

In live settings, it’s beneficial to make adjustments in real-time as performers engage with the audience. I had a situation during a jazz performance where the saxophonist’s sound felt a bit lost. Instead of waiting for the next break, I adjusted the midrange frequencies on the fly. You know, it’s exhilarating to see a performer’s energy uplift when they hear their instrument shining through the mix.

Always remember the influence of the audience; their reactions can guide your EQ decisions. At a recent rock concert, I noticed the crowd vibing with certain frequencies, so I made a quick boost at around 5 kHz. Seeing the energy in the room shift was electrifying—it confirmed my instinct that sometimes, letting the audience’s energy dictate adjustments can lead to a far superior experience. How often do we overlook the power of live feedback, after all?
